that building is a grain elevator. there are about 4-5 buildings on that site all related to the complex. the far south buildings are fallingin on themselves. it is a well guarded site as they dismantle corvettes and other high end cars. the farthest i ever got in was the first floor of the elevator . it is in the DB on uer......

Post by hearse driver »

the staircase did exist at one point and was used as a emergency exit when the mine was in use. good luck getting in as they are renovating it into solar business park. there is 24 hour security as well as patrolls by the sheriff. we wee caught trying to enter last year by the grandson of the owner . he let us drive our truck through part of the mine but mos of it was mud and muck.
